The most common inter family adoption is a step parent or grandparent adoption. Many times the step parent will want to make the emotional bond a legal bond through adoption. This legal step often includes a name change.

WebJun 26, 2015 · Intercountry adoption is among the range of stable care options. For individual children who cannot be cared for in a family setting in their country of origin, intercountry adoption may be the best permanent solution.
